My work is grounded in both deep academic study and extensive experiential practice combining intellectual rigour with embodied, human-centred approaches to growth, communication, and transformation.
I hold a Master’s degree focused on interpretation, culture, and the ways human beings create meaning, relationships, behaviours, and systems of interaction. I also hold Honours degrees in Psychology and Comparative Literature & Art History.
As a PCC (Professional Certified Coach) accredited by the International Coaching Federation, I coach, train, and assess high-level practitioners and leaders. I am also internationally certified as a TRE® (Tension & Trauma Release Exercises) provider through the official global accreditation body.
My background includes qualifications in Speech & Drama through Trinity College Dublin, alongside experience as a moderator and assessor for SACAP and the South African Qualifications Authority.
Over many years, I have trained across a wide range of disciplines including Tai Chi, Yoga, Process Work, embodiment practices, communication methodologies, and transformational facilitation — studying with respected teachers internationally.
